#ifndef _DEV_VIDEOMODE_VESAGTF_H
 | 
						|
#define _DEV_VIDEOMODE_VESAGTF_H
 | 
						|
 | 
						|
/*
 | 
						|
 * Use VESA GTF formula to generate a monitor mode, given resolution and
 | 
						|
 * refresh rates.
 | 
						|
 */
 | 
						|
 | 
						|
struct vesagtf_params {
 | 
						|
	unsigned	margin_ppt;	/* vertical margin size, percent * 10
 | 
						|
					 * think parts-per-thousand */
 | 
						|
	unsigned	min_porch;	/* minimum front porch */
 | 
						|
	unsigned	vsync_rqd;	/* width of vsync in lines */
 | 
						|
	unsigned	hsync_pct;	/* hsync as % of total width */
 | 
						|
	unsigned	min_vsbp;	/* minimum vsync + back porch (usec) */
 | 
						|
	unsigned	M;		/* blanking formula gradient */
 | 
						|
	unsigned	C;		/* blanking formula offset */
 | 
						|
	unsigned	K;		/* blanking formula scaling factor */
 | 
						|
	unsigned	J;		/* blanking formula scaling factor */
 | 
						|
};
 | 
						|
 | 
						|
/*
 | 
						|
 * Default values to use for params.
 | 
						|
 */
 | 
						|
#define	VESAGTF_MARGIN_PPT	18	/* 1.8% */
 | 
						|
#define	VESAGTF_MIN_PORCH	1	/* minimum front porch */
 | 
						|
#define	VESAGTF_VSYNC_RQD	3	/* vsync width in lines */
 | 
						|
#define	VESAGTF_HSYNC_PCT	8	/* width of hsync % of total line */
 | 
						|
#define	VESAGTF_MIN_VSBP	550	/* min vsync + back porch (usec) */
 | 
						|
#define	VESAGTF_M		600	/* blanking formula gradient */
 | 
						|
#define	VESAGTF_C		40	/* blanking formula offset */
 | 
						|
#define	VESAGTF_K		128	/* blanking formula scaling factor */
 | 
						|
#define	VESAGTF_J		20	/* blanking formula scaling factor */
 | 
						|
 | 
						|
/*
 | 
						|
 * Use VESA GTF formula to generate monitor timings.  Assumes default
 | 
						|
 * GTF parameters, non-interlaced, and no margins.
 | 
						|
 */
 | 
						|
void vesagtf_mode(unsigned x, unsigned y, unsigned refresh,
 | 
						|
    struct videomode *);
 | 
						|
 | 
						|
/*
 | 
						|
 * A more complete version, in case we ever want to use alternate GTF
 | 
						|
 * parameters.  EDID 1.3 allows for "secondary GTF parameters".
 | 
						|
 */
 | 
						|
void vesagtf_mode_params(unsigned x, unsigned y, unsigned refresh,
 | 
						|
    struct vesagtf_params *, int flags, struct videomode *);
 | 
						|
 | 
						|
#define	VESAGTF_FLAG_ILACE	0x0001		/* use interlace */
 | 
						|
#define	VESAGTF_FLAG_MARGINS	0x0002		/* use margins */
 | 
						|
 | 
						|
#endif /* _DEV_VIDEOMODE_VESAGTF_H */
